On Tue, 2008-04-22 at 16:30 -0400, Mike McLean wrote:
> I'm pretty sure the F8 updates are sufficient to run koji. I've had an 
> F8 system running koji development code (hub, client, builder, and 
> kojira) for a while now.
> 
> $ koji latest-pkg --quiet dist-f8-updates mock yum createrepo python-krbV
> mock-0.9.7-2.fc8                          dist-f8-updates       jcwillia
> yum-3.2.8-2.fc8                           dist-f8-updates       skvidal
> createrepo-0.4.11-2.fc8                   dist-f8-updates       lmacken
> python-krbV-1.0.13-6.fc8                  dist-f8               mikeb
> 
> Well, ok, I'm cheating a little bit. I previously had to make skip-stat 
> optional in kojid (change committed on the shadow branch), but that 
> appears to no longer be necessary since createrepo-0.4.11-2.fc8 has the 
> skip-stat patch.
> 
> http://koji.fedoraproject.org/koji/buildinfo?buildID=32381

Gotcha, now that everything is almost in sync, it would be a good time
to do another upstream release and push it to F8 as well.
